The Unauthorized Autobiography of Samantha Brown, a new musical by Kerrigan-Lowdermilk, is set for a run at The Norma Terris Theatre (in Chester, Conn) August 4 - 28, 2011. I've only heard 6 of the songs, but what I've heard feels like a wonderful, sweet story about a young girl navigating the transition from high school to college. I think it's spunky but poignant and I can't wait to see a full production staged.
